Sustaining synthetic chlorinated swimming pools demands regular monitoring of chlorine levels and drinking water quality. Pool operators and homeowners will have to Check out the chlorine concentration regularly to guarantee it stays inside the advisable selection. As well minimal chlorine can lead to inadequate sanitation, letting bacteria and algae to thrive. Alternatively, abnormal chlorine amounts might cause pores and skin and eye discomfort for swimmers. The perfect chlorine level for synthetic chlorinated swimming pools ordinarily falls among one and three parts per million (ppm). Preserving this harmony is important for supplying a comfortable and Safe and sound swimming experience.
Together with chlorine ranges, synthetic chlorinated pools involve proper pH equilibrium. The pH of pool h2o really should Preferably be concerning seven.2 and seven.6. In case the pH is too minimal, the h2o will become acidic, leading to corrosion of pool equipment and irritation for swimmers. Should the pH is just too higher, chlorine gets to be much less effective, reducing its capability to sanitize the water. Normal screening and adjustment of pH concentrations support make certain that artificial chlorinated pools continue to be well-balanced and comfortable for people. Pool entrepreneurs frequently use pH tests kits and chemical changes to maintain the proper pH concentrations in their pools.
A different crucial facet of synthetic chlorinated pools is the use of stabilizers. Chlorine can degrade immediately when exposed to sunlight, minimizing its performance to be a disinfectant. To fight this, pool proprietors usually insert cyanuric acid, a stabilizer that can help prolong the lifetime of chlorine in outside pools. With out stabilizers, chlorine levels can fall promptly, necessitating Regular additions to maintain good sanitation. By using the right number of stabilizer, synthetic chlorinated pools can continue to be cleaner for more time periods with small chlorine decline.

Despite the numerous advantages of artificial chlorinated pools, it is crucial for pool proprietors and operators to observe security tips and best procedures. Good storage and handling of chlorine and various pool chemicals are vital to circumvent mishaps and chemical imbalances. Chlorine really should be saved in the awesome, dry spot faraway from immediate sunlight and incompatible substances. Mixing chlorine with other chemical compounds, for example ammonia or acids, can deliver unsafe reactions. Pool routine maintenance personnel needs to be skilled in chemical basic safety and observe proposed guidelines for handling and application.
